Case outline

The U.S. Marshals - New Hampshire Joint Fugitive Task Force is requesting public assistance in its efforts to locate and arrest Strafford Count fugitive, Grant William Ohlson, who is wanted failing to appear for an arraignment in a case where Ohlson is alleged to have smuggled fentanyl into the Strafford County Jail. In addition, Ohlson has active warrants for Theft, Probation Violations, and Criminal Trespass. Ohlson is known to be violent and has recently been associated with the possession and/or transfer of firearms. Ohlson has strong ties to Dover, Somersworth, Rochester and Farmington.
